NVW is currently seeking applicants for Full Time and Seasonal Wilderness Instructors at our Medford Wisconsin location. Instructors provide a safe, therapeutic atmosphere in a wilderness context for our groups of struggling teens. Wilderness Instructors are responsible for groups of up to nine students on backpacking, canoeing, and other outdoor expeditions and will work several days straight in the wilderness (typically an 8-day on/6-day off schedule). Instructors are responsible for group structure, supervision, safety, curriculum facilitation, teaching wilderness skills, and will be working hand in hand with NVW therapists who treat our children. Day to day programming responsibilities include: risk management, implementation of program philosophy, student supervision, leadership and responsible decision making, communication, and the overall care and welfare of up to 9 students in a wilderness context. 
 
 
Qualifications:
  • Wilderness Field Guides must be at least 21 years old. BS/BA degree or comparable experience working in the adventure or outdoor field with at-risk youth is preferred.
  • Excellent leadership, communication and problem-solving skills.
  • Must possess and maintain current CPR certification (WFR preferred)
  • Ability to lift and carry 50+ pounds for extended durations
  • Must be able to pass a Background Criminal Investigation.
  • Must hold a valid Driver's License with clean driving record. 
  • Must pass a post-employment offer medical physical
